#efe634 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#efe634 is composed of 93.7% red, 90.2%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.8% magenta, 78.2%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 57.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.4% and a lightness of 57.1%. #efe634 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ff68 with #dfcd00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

#efe634 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#efe634 has RGB values of R:239, G:230,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.04, Y:0.78,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15722036.

Shades and Tints of #efe634
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0f01 is the darkest color, while #fffff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#efe634
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929291 is the less saturated color, while #f7ee2c is the most saturated one.
